A PENSIONER has been airlifted to hospital with severe injuries after falling from a Lake District fell.
The 65-year-old man from Ulverston fell on Coniston Old Man and dislocated his shoulder, suffered facial injuries and had hypothermia.
The Great North Air Ambulance (GNAAS) was called to to the aid of the man at 12.30pm yesterday (February 11).
He was treated by Coniston Mountain Rescue Team and a GNAAS doctor before being flown to Furness General Hospital.
His condition was stable on arrival.
